Lee Kiser is the co-founder of Kiser Group, a member of the Forbes Real Estate Council, and a wealth of knowledge in the Chicago market (and a local musician!). In today’s episode, Lee provides his thoughts on how today’s hot market differs from 2005, how institutional and private money has altered apartment investing in Chicago, and what neighborhoods are on the rise.

Lee dishes out advice on subtle value-add opportunities, steps to avoid to ensure a smooth operation, and how to show credibility when interacting with brokers.
